Joe Jonas Posts Note on "Doing the Right Thing" After Sophie Turner Agreement

Amid his ongoing divorce proceedings with estranged wife Sophie Turner, Joe Jonas shared a cryptic message from backstage at a Jonas Brothers' tour stop in Nashville.
In the Oct. 11 post to his Instagram Story, Joe's reflection—first looking down and then directly ahead—can be seen in a mirror with the question, "What do you want them to feel?" written around on the rim. However, on the mirror itself, someone has written the phrase, "I am at the right place at the right time, doing the right thing."
The eyebrow-raising note comes just two days after Joe and Sophie reached a temporary custody agreement for their two daughters: Willa, 2, and a 14-month-old whose initials are DMJ. Per legal documents viewed by E! News, the singer, 34, and the Game of Thrones star, 27, have agreed to split their time with their children equally through the New Year, allowing each parent to have their daughters for different holidays.
In light of the agreement, Joe and Sophie made it clear they're looking ahead to their coparenting future.
"After a productive and successful mediation, we have agreed that the children will spend time equally in loving homes in both the U.S. and the U.K.," the former couple shared in a statement to E! News on Oct. 10. "We look forward to being great co-parents."
The agreement comes after Sophie filed a lawsuit Joe in late September, alleging that the "Only Human" singer was preventing their children—who have citizenship in both the U.K and U.S—to return to their "their habitual residence of England."
In response to the suit, spokesperson for Joe adamantly denied Sophie's claims and said in a statement to E! News, "Joe is seeking shared parenting with the kids so that they are raised by both their mother and father, and is of course also okay with the kids being raised both in the U.S. and the U.K."
Under their temporary custody agreement, Sophie has leave to take their daughters to England while they are with her.
The news of Joe and Sophie's split after four years of marriage came on Sept. 5 when the "Cake By The Ocean" singer filed for divorce from the Dark Phoenix star. The following day, the two shared a joint statement to their social media.
"After four wonderful years of marriage we have mutually decided to amicably end our marriage," read their Sept. 6 message. "There are many speculative narratives as to why but, truly this is a united decision and we sincerely hope that everyone can respect our wishes for privacy for us and our children."
